Output 81ebc4367e7ce56737dbc3d994bb69c691de9de4f7220b835c685077381a2850:3

value
99079713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ee3f97d61d04ec36073e24851be71a6c4e99aa2e OP_EQUAL
address
MVcuEcV9bpRNLHZfXQoihfiWSUMAocopbZ
transaction
81ebc4367e7ce56737dbc3d994bb69c691de9de4f7220b835c685077381a2850
spent
true